The electronic configuration is used to explain the orbitals of an atom and it helps to determine the physical and chemical properties of the elements. The electronic configuration of zinc is 1s²2s²2p⁶3s²3p⁶4s²3d¹⁰. The correct option is C.

What is electronic configuration?

The distribution of electrons in the atomic orbitals is given by the electronic configuration. It is a standard notation in which all the electrons holding atomic subshells are arranged in a sequence. Each element has a unique electronic configuration.

The electronic configuration of an element can be written in two ways, in standard notation, and in condensed form. In the case of elements with larger atomic numbers, the electronic configuration becomes lengthy in standard notation. So in such cases condensed form is generally used.

In condensed form electronic configuration of zinc is [Ar] 3d¹⁰4s² and in standard form it is 1s²2s²2p⁶3s²3p⁶4s²3d¹⁰.

Thus the correct option is C.

Luisa likes to drink water from a plastic bottle. She knows the bottles were formed from synthetic polymers that were created in a chemical reaction. She also knows that synthetic materials can cause problems. Which statement explains the kind of problem that can develop from using synthetic materials such as plastics?

Answers

Complete question: Luisa likes to drink water from a plastic bottle. She knows the bottles were formed from synthetic polymers that were created in a chemical reaction. She also knows that synthetic materials can cause problems. Which statement explains the kind of problem that can develop from using synthetic materials such as plastics?

a) plastics have changed the way people use materials

b) plastics have made the lives of people easier

c) plastics have contributed to more pollution

d) plastics have made more work for people

Answer: The correct statement is plastics have contributed to more pollution. Option C.

Explanation:

Synthetic polymers are commonly called plastics. These are referred to as synthetic materials which can be softened by heat or pressure and then moulded into any desirable shape like the the plastic bottle Luisa drank from.

The raw materials for the manufacture of plastics are readily and cheaply available for the refinement of crude oil through series of chemical reactions. They are made by polymerization of monomers which are derived from petrochemicals.

Although they are used in producing materials used daily, it has contributed to more pollution over the years. POLLUTION is the release of chemicals or substances through man's activities, into the environment which causes harm to both man and the environment.

Plastics have contributed to more pollution because most plastics are non- biodegradable and cannot be broken down by microbial action into simple inorganic forms. Therefore, they cause severe land pollution problems since they are not easily disposable. Also is poses a major problem to the world supply of crude oil as it's limited. This is as a result of heavy dependence on crude oil which provides petrochemicals that is the bulk of the raw materials needed for making plastics.

2C2H6 + 7O2 ------> 4CO2 + 6H2O


If you are given 10 grams of C2H6 and 10 grams of O2 how many grams of H2O would you produce? Hint: find the limiting reactant. Answer should have 3 decimal places.

Right answer gets brainliest

Answers

We convert the masses of our reactants to moles and use the stoichiometric coefficients to determine which one of our reactants will be limiting.

Dividing the mass of each reactant by its molar mass:

(10 g C2H6)(30.069 g/mol) = 0.3326 mol C2H6

(10 g O2)(31.999 g/mol) = 0.3125 mol O2.

Every 2 moles of C2H6 react with 7 moles of O2. So the number of moles of O2 needed to react completely with 0.3326 mol C2H6 would be (0.3326)(7/2) = 1.164 mol O2. That is far more than the number of moles of O2 that we are given: 0.3125 moles. Thus, O2 is our limiting reactant.

Since O2 is the limiting reactant, its quantity will determine how much of each product is formed. We are asked to find the number of grams (the mass) of H2O produced. The molar ratio between H2O and O2 per the balanced equation is 6:7. That is, for every 6 moles of H2O that is produced, 7 moles of O2 is used up (intuitively, then, the number of moles of H2O produced should be less than the number of moles of O2 consumed).

So, the number of moles of H2O produced would be (0.3125 mol O2)(6 mol H2O/7 mol O2) = 0.2679 mol H2O. We multiply by the molar mass of H2O to convert moles to mass: (0.2679 mol H2O)(18.0153 g/mol) = 4.826 g H2O.

Given 10 grams of C2H6 and 10 grams of O2, 4.826 g of H2O are produced.

How many moles of methanol would be created if you started the reaction with 36.7 g of hydrogen gas?
(Round to 1 decimal place.)
Molar Masses:
H2= 202 g/mol
CO = 28.01 g/mol
CH3OH = 32.04 g.mol

Answers

Answer:

9.1 mol

Explanation:

The balanced chemical equation of the reaction is:

CO (g) + 2H2 (g) → CH3OH (l)

According to the above balanced equation, 2 moles of hydrogen gas (H2) are needed to produce 1 mole of methanol (CH3OH).

To convert 36.7 g of hydrogen gas to moles, we use the formula;

mole = mass/molar mass

Molar mass of H2 = 2.02g/mol

mole = 36.7/2.02

mole = 18.17mol

This means that if;

2 moles of H2 reacts to produce 1 mole of CH3OH

18.17mol of H2 will react to produce;

18.17 × 1 / 2

= 18.17/2

= 9.085

Approximately to 1 d.p = 9.1 mol of methanol (CH3OH).
